引言
随着全球经济的快速发展,制造业正面临着前所未有的变革。智能制造作为新一代信息技术与制造业深度融合的产物,已经成为推动产业升级、提升国家竞争力的关键因素。本文将深入探讨智能制造的创新技术,分析其对未来产业变革的影响。
智能制造的定义与特点
定义
智能制造是指在数字化、网络化、智能化技术的基础上,通过信息物理系统(Cyber-Physical Systems,CPS)实现生产过程的自动化、智能化和集成化,从而提高生产效率、降低成本、提升产品质量。
特点
- 数字化:利用物联网、大数据等技术,实现生产数据的实时采集、传输和分析。
- 网络化:通过互联网、工业互联网等网络技术,实现生产设备的互联互通。
- 智能化:利用人工智能、机器学习等技术,实现生产过程的自主决策和优化。
- 集成化:将生产、管理、服务等环节进行整合,实现全产业链的协同发展。
智能制造的关键技术
物联网(IoT)
物联网技术是实现智能制造的基础,通过传感器、控制器等设备,实现生产设备的实时监测和远程控制。
# 示例:使用Python编写一个简单的物联网设备控制程序
import socket
# 创建一个TCP/IP socket
s =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
# 连接到服务器
s.connect(('192.168.1.10', 8080))
# 发送控制命令
s.sendall(b'open')
# 接收服务器响应
data = s.recv(1024)
print('Received:', data.decode())
# 关闭连接
s.close()
大数据
大数据技术通过对海量生产数据的分析,为智能制造提供决策支持。
# 示例:使用Python进行数据可视化
import matplotlib.pyplot as plt
import pandas as pd
# 加载数据
data = pd.read_csv('production_data.csv')
# 绘制折线图
plt.plot(data['time'], data['output'])
plt.xlabel('时间')
plt.ylabel('产量')
plt.title('生产数据折线图')
plt.show()
人工智能与机器学习
人工智能与机器学习技术是实现智能制造智能化的关键,通过算法模型实现生产过程的自主决策和优化。
# 示例:使用Python进行机器学习
from sklearn.linear_model import LinearRegression
# 加载数据
data = pd.read_csv('production_data.csv')
# 特征和标签
X = data[['time', 'input']]
y = data['output']
# 创建线性回归模型
model = LinearRegression()
# 训练模型
model.fit(X, y)
# 预测
prediction = model.predict([[10, 100]])
print('预测产量:', prediction)
云计算
云计算技术为智能制造提供强大的计算能力和数据存储能力,实现生产过程的弹性扩展和协同发展。
# 示例:使用Python调用云计算API
import requests
# 调用API
response = requests.get('https://api.cloud.com/service')
print('API响应:', response.json())
智能制造的未来发展趋势
个性化定制
随着消费者需求的多样化,智能制造将朝着个性化定制的方向发展,实现按需生产。
智能化服务
智能制造将不仅仅局限于生产环节,还将涵盖产品设计、生产、销售、服务等全产业链。
绿色制造
智能制造将注重环保和可持续发展,实现绿色生产。
结论
智能制造作为新一代信息技术与制造业深度融合的产物,正引领着未来产业变革。通过不断创新技术,智能制造将为我国制造业转型升级提供强大动力,助力我国成为全球制造业强国。
